LOUISE CHARBONNEL is a singer-songwriter whose debut album in progress, "How To Be Confused About Happiness", lays the foundations for a distinctive art pop universe. She began her career as a performer in various stage productions before joining the cast of STARMANIA, directed by Thomas Jolly, where she appeared in over 250 performances between 2022 and 2024, as understudy for Marie-Jeanne. At the same time, she has been developing her own musical writing through an art pop project blending classical, jazz, and electronic influences. This work is coming to life in her debut album, "How To Be Confused About Happiness", scheduled for release in 2026. Each song explores the ambiguities of happiness, navigating between tension and softness, structure and surrender. Selected for the 2025 edition of Les Inouïs du Printemps de Bourges and supported by the Génération Spedidam program, she is building a project centered around melodies, textures, and voice.
